Our next big event: National Gay Straight Alliance Day!

For the past five years, Iowa has celebrated Iowa GSA Day during the last week of January. This year, we're taking it national! For the first time ever, there will be a national celebration of GSA Day on January 25, 2012!


GSA Day was started as a way to celebrate and honor our high school and college GSAs. Studies show that students who have a Gay-Straight Alliance in their school report decreased absenteeism and lower rates of name calling, harassment and assault. For decades, GSAs have been working to make their campuses safe places for all students regardless of sexual orientation or gender identity. Students who start and take part in these student groups are brave. They dare to create a dialogue to improve lives. We believe that courage deserves to be recognized, to be celebrated!
